Bakery

Small coffee shop offering almond milk. Also serves vegan pastries, donuts, and cookies. Open Mon-Sun 6:00am-6:00pm.

Everything for a couple of bucks

This is a coffee shop where every item sells (at the time of this writing) for $2--coffee, deserts, snacks, etc. There is no seating, this is a takeout place (unless you stand to drink your coffee). The coffee is fine, and they offer vegan milks (as do most NYC coffee places). Only a few food items are vegan, such a heavily sugar-laden vegan donut. They have some white-floured, bread, vegetarian (not vegan) savory snacks as well, which don't look particularly healthy or appetizing (though they are only $2 each). I am not sure why this is listed as a bakery on Happy Cow--because of the vegan donut? In any case, though inexpensive coffee is nice, this is not really a Happy Cow-type place.





Updated from previous review on 2019-09-26

Pros: Inexpensive coffee, Quick service, vegan milks for coffee

Cons: The one vegan food item is sugary, not healthy oriented, not really a vegan bakery/food place
